About Eastern Hills EL
Eastern Hills Elementary is a public elementary school located in the heart of Fort Worth, Texas. Serving students from pre-kindergarten through fifth grade, Eastern Hills has an enrollment of 458 students and maintains a student-teacher ratio of 17:1 with 27 full-time equivalent teachers. The school’s academic performance shows that there is room for growth; currently, about 24% of students are proficient in both ELA/Reading and Math.
While the MySchoolScout Rating places Eastern Hills at the lower end of its peer group, it serves a large city community where educational focus includes nurturing student development beyond test scores. Eastern Hills Elementary is situated in an urban setting within Fort Worth, providing opportunities for diverse learning experiences and community engagement.

Performance Trends
Math proficiency has declined from 35% (2019) to 13% (2021). Reading/ELA proficiency has declined from 29% (2019) to 19% (2021).

Community Profile
The community surrounding Eastern Hills EL has a median household income of $56,179. It is a community where 21%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$207,100, with a median rent of $1,215/month. The area has a poverty rate of 21.4%, indicating some economic challenges in the community. The average commute for residents is 25 minutes.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.
